  • In this episode, Teal brings back a 'golden oldie' of spiritual practice. The practice of stepping into the perspective of the observer self. She demonstrates a mindfulness meditation for the viewer to try. Mindfulness meditation enables us to step outside the ego and into the perspective of the soul.

    I love how you explained what mindful meditation is.
    Ive been trying this meditation out and it works wonders.
    I've slowly been realizing that I have choices on how I want to react to emotions. Choices meaning on how to react to negative emotions.
    A good example would be anger.
    My mind comes to a state of awareness and it sort of feels like I'm in a crossroad.
    In this crossroad, I have a choice on whether to act violently to that anger or simply let go of the anger and try a peaceful alternative.
    It's like you become aware at that moment everytime and you can realize that reacting to the anger in a violent or unhealthy way, never really worked. What I mean by "never really worked," I'm simply stating that I've become aware that through my years living on this Earth, I have noticed that my classic reactions to anger never solved the peoblem, never eased my mind, and it never ended in a positive manner.
    This meditation practice is extremely helpful for all of us.
